Output 3531e8d031578d08af285371bfa7089e9e644a1b30effe30ea24feef2ff31e00: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 441a5d4bdc64309be03930aa665a21a7bb65427d OP_EQUALVERIFY OP_CHECKSIG
address
17D6XsutQnVTjpWDSrR3hFrKGZcyhrkVP8
transaction
3531e8d031578d08af285371bfa7089e9e644a1b30effe30ea24feef2ff31e00
confirmations
458879
spent
true